    Community Context

    Orange Heights in Southeast Arcadia is a relatively small, rural community. Arcadia itself has a population of about 7,500-8,000, and the area is known for its agricultural roots and tight-knit community feel. Schools here reflect the challenges of rural education, including limited funding and resources compared to urban districts. However, many families value the smaller class sizes and personal attention students may receive.
